amercear (first-person singular present amerceio, first-person singular preterite amerceei, past participle amerceado)

  1. (transitive) to do mercy to; to grant mercy to
  2. (transitive) to commute a sentence to
  3. (takes a reflexive pronoun) to pity, sympathize, feel sorry for
